What material is a ladle made from?

steel
An open-topped cylindrical container made of heavy steel plates and lined with refractory, the ladle is used for holding and transporting liquid steel.

What is foundry ladle?

a vessel for holding molten metal and conveying it from cupola to the molds. See also: Foundry.

What is a smelting ladle?

In metallurgy, a ladle is a vessel used to transport and pour out molten metals. Many non-ferrous foundries also use ceramic crucibles for transporting and pouring molten metal and will also refer to these as ladles.

What are foundries made of?

The most common metals processed are aluminum and cast iron. However, other metals, such as bronze, brass, steel, magnesium, and zinc, are also used to produce castings in foundries.

What is foundry crucible?

A crucible is a pot that is used to keep metals for melting in a furnace. Furnace crucibles are designed to withstand the highest temperatures encountered in the metal casting works.

What is the difference between a forge and a foundry?

A foundry melts metals in special furnaces to be cast into molds. A forge is a furnace or hearth where metals are heated prior to hammering them into shape. The act of forging is heating and hammering metal into a shape.
